Yappy Beeman performs live honey bee removals in Alabama and relocates them to apiaries away from residential areas so they can rebuild and thrive as a honey bee colony producing honey. Yappy is an Alabama Beekeepers association member that has preformed over 1500 live bee removals. Yappy, along with the help of his great friends, Jp The Beeman, 628DirtRooster, Jeff Horchoff, and many others has learned many ways to remove bees safely for the bees and homeowners alike.

Noone makes you beekeep without a suit, and no other beekeeper will think less of it. There are these beekeeping onesies/overall/suits with veils zipped on, so the odds of an adventurous bee sneaking under a coat rim or pants is minimal. you can stuff the hoses of your pants in your socks or in sturdy boots so they wont crawl up your pants. Get good fit sturdy kitchen gloves and close the gap with the velcro sleeves of the suit. The " shame" is all in your head. It's better even to start with good protection and learn how to keep those bees without too much fear of getting stung. Eventually you'll get a little tired of getting all kitted up for every little thing, and can gauge when you can get away without. Or not and just gear up. It's perfectly fine. How do you remove the queen from that plastic box once they are all inside ? Thanks fro sharing this video
I go back in after a few days and take the cap off and she walks right out into the hive. It just helps hold the bees there a few days so they set up the new home for her and not leave.

I've tried this same thing when I found that one of my hives swarmed and it landed in an apple tree 5 feet off the ground. The bees stayed in the hive and when I released the queen 2.5 days later they all left immediately and went to the top of a 70 foot tall pine tree and within a few hours they all flew away. IMO... these videos are just pure luck that the bees stay. In my experience, a 6-8 pound swarm of bees won't find a 5-frame nuc box big enough to stay in and they leave to find a better new home.
